After analyzing centuries of cultural resilience and political shifts, Cathie Carmichael and James Gow offer a nuanced portrait of Slovenia's journey from a small Habsburg territory to a sovereign nation in modern Europe. You gain insight into the persistence of Slovene language and peasant democracy dating back to the ninth century, alongside the challenges of post-communist transition and identity formation after Yugoslavia's breakup. This book is tailored for anyone eager to understand how Slovenia balances integration into European structures with preserving its unique heritage, illustrated by historical episodes like the 1557 Slovene Bible and contemporary political developments. If you want a thoughtful exploration rather than a surface overview, this book provides context and detail that enrich your grasp of Slovenia’s evolving story.

What happens when a historian immerses deeply in a region often overlooked yet pivotal? Oto Luthar developed a nuanced account in "The Land Between" that traces Slovenia's geographic and cultural crossroads from the Pannonian plain to the Adriatic coast. Rather than simply narrating events, Luthar illuminates how the Slovenes emerged through complex interactions with Celto-Roman populations and successive historical layers, challenging simplistic settlement stories. You gain insight into Slovenia’s multifaceted identity across feudal times and the 20th century, along with the region's evolving place in Central Europe and the Balkans. This book suits you if you’re eager to understand the intricate historical forces shaping Slovenia’s unique position and people.

Drawing from a deep exploration of Slovenian alpine culture and post-war history, Bernadette McDonald traces how Slovenia's harsh mountain landscape shaped a generation of climbers who thrived amid political upheaval. You learn about the evolution of Slovenian alpinism from the 1960s through the 1990s, intertwined with Yugoslavia's shifting political scene and Tito’s unique governance. The book details training methods, key expeditions in the Himalayas, and the climbers’ resilience during times of scarcity and conflict. If you’re fascinated by the intersection of sport, history, and national identity, this narrative offers a vivid lens into how adversity influenced world-class mountaineering.

Peter Starič's firsthand account captures the turbulent history of Slovenia from 1941 to 1991, blending personal experience with critical historical insight. You learn not only about the harsh realities of life under Italian and German occupation but also the grim transition to communist totalitarianism post-World War II, including detailed descriptions of concentration camps and the secret mass graves revealed after Slovenia's independence. This narrative offers a rare, unvarnished look at the political shifts and human costs in a region often overshadowed in broader European history. If you're drawn to deeply personal historical testimonies that illuminate complex political landscapes, this book will expand your understanding.

Leopoldina Plut-Pregelj and Carole Rogel bring decades of historical scholarship to this detailed compendium that traces Slovenia's journey from centuries under foreign rule to its emergence as an independent nation. You gain insight into pivotal events like the 1990 independence vote and the complex dissolution of Yugoslavia, framed through a rich chronology and extensive dictionary entries on key figures, institutions, and cultural touchstones. The book serves as a valuable reference for anyone wanting to understand the political, social, and economic transformations that shaped modern Slovenia, from its communist past to its integration into NATO and the EU. If you seek a nuanced, encyclopedic resource rather than a narrative history, this is well worth your attention.

During his quarter-century tenure as Secretary of the Carniolan Historical Society, August Dimitz developed a deep understanding of Slovenian cultural evolution, which fueled his detailed chronicle of Carniola's history. This extensive volume, originally written in German and now accessible in English, offers you a comprehensive exploration of Slovenia from ancient times through the death of Emperor Frederick III in 1493. You'll find rich narratives on political shifts, social structures, and cultural developments that shaped the region’s identity. If you're fascinated by the roots of Slovenian heritage or tracing genealogical connections, this book provides a solid foundation grounded in meticulous historical research.
